Nocturnal diuresis in panhypopituitarism

Summary
Patients with panhypopituitarism exhibit distinct nocturnal water excretion patterns, showing significant diuresis at night despite low cortisol levels. This contrasts with morning antidiuresis, highlighting unique physiological responses.

Background:
- Impaired water diuresis is recognized in adrenocortical insufficiency.
- Nocturnal diuretic patterns in endocrine disorders remain under-investigated.
Observation:
- Two panhypopituitarism patients displayed different morning and nocturnal diuretic responses.
- Marked nocturnal diuresis occurred after water loading, independent of serum cortisol levels.
- Morning antidiuresis showed rising urine osmolality despite water loading and limited response to vasopressin.
Findings:
- Water loading at night induced diuresis in panhypopituitarism patients, unlike in the morning.
- The kidneys showed limited response to vasopressin and glucose infusion in the morning.
- Furosemide rapidly restored diuretic response, while glucocorticoid replacement had a 2-hour latent effect.
Implications:
- Nocturnal physiological mechanisms for diuresis may operate independently of glucocorticoids.
- Understanding these diurnal variations is crucial for managing fluid balance in endocrine disorders.
- Further research is needed to elucidate the latent period of glucocorticoid action on diuresis.
